About Jonathan Shear

Jonathan Shear is a scholar working on Social Psychology, Clinical Psychology, Cognitive Neuroscience, Philosophy and History and Philosophy of Science, having authored 29 papers that have together received 1.5k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Mindfulness and Compassion Interventions (7 papers), Paranormal Experiences and Beliefs (5 papers), Theology and Philosophy of Evil (3 papers), Behavioral Health and Interventions (2 papers), Olfactory and Sensory Function Studies (2 papers), Sleep and Wakefulness Research (2 papers), Child and Animal Learning Development (1 paper) and Religion, Spirituality, and Psychology (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Clinical Psychology (671 citations), Cognitive Neuroscience (567 citations), Experimental and Cognitive Psychology (317 citations), Social Psychology (471 citations) and Applied Psychology (83 citations). Jonathan Shear has collaborated with scholars based in United States. Frequent co-authors include Francisco J. Varela, Fred Travis, Allan I. Abrams, K. Eppley, Shaun Gallagher, R. Jevning, Francisco J. Varela and Frederick Travis.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Consciousness Studies, Metaphilosophy, Consciousness and Cognition, Sophia and The Journal of Creative Behavior.
